    Solution 1: Reset the networking hardware

    Turn off your Xbox 360 console and network hardware (for example, your modem and router).

    Wait 30 seconds.

    Turn on the modem and wait for it to come back online (one minute).

    Turn on the next hardware (eg a router) and wait another minute.

    Repeat step 4 for each additional networking hardware.

    Turn on the console, go to My Xbox and select System Settings.

    Select Network Settings.

    Select WiredNet or the name of the wireless network if prompted to do so.

    Select Test Xbox LIVE Connection.

    If you get the same MTU error, try the next solution.

    Solution 2 (wireless only): Improve wireless signal

    If you're connecting to Xbox LIVE using a wireless connection, the MTU error might be due to a weak wireless signal.

    Check if the wireless signal strength needs to increase. See how:

    On the Xbox 360 console, go to My Xbox and select System Settings.

    Select Network Settings.

    Select WiredNet or the name of the wireless network if prompted to do so.

    Select Test Xbox LIVE Connection.

    If the signal strength is one or two bars, try increasing it.

    Wireless signal strength in one or two bars

    Follow these tips to increase wireless signal strength:

    Remove the router or gateway from the floor and walls and metal objects (such as metal file cabinets).

    Minimize obstructions in the straight path between your Xbox 360 console and your wireless router or gateway.

    Reduce the distance between the console and the wireless router or gateway. Ideally, networking hardware is located near the center of your home.

    Change the position of the antenna on the Xbox 360 Wireless Networking Adapter (external adapter only).

    Turn off wireless devices. If the router uses the 2.4 gigahertz (GHz) band, try turning off wireless devices such as 2.4GHz cordless phones and Bluetooth devices.

    Try changing the wireless channel. Wireless routers and gateways can broadcast on different channels, and one channel may be clearer than another. See your hardware documentation for help changing wireless channels.

    Add a wireless repeater to extend your wireless network range. You can increase signal strength by placing a wireless repeater midway between the router and the console.

    Switch wireless signal bands. If you have a dual-band router and an external wireless adapter, try switching the router to a wireless protocol that transmits in the 5GHz band (wireless A or N protocol). See your hardware documentation for help changing the wireless protocol.

    Add an Xbox 360 Wireless N Networking Adapter (Xbox 360 S console). If the wireless router is not near the console, an Xbox 360 Wireless N Networking Adapter may improve signal strength. When you connect a wireless network adapter to an Xbox 360 S console, the console will automatically use the wireless adapter instead of the built-in Wi-Fi.     Solution 3: Simplify Setup

    The router or gateway may be having difficulty sharing an Internet connection. To find out if this is true, try simplifying the configuration.

    Do one of the following:

    If you have a wired connection: Temporarily disconnect everything but the modem cable and Xbox 360 console cable from the router.

    If you have a wireless connection: Temporarily turn off everything connected to the wireless network except your Xbox 360 console.

    Test your Xbox LIVE connection:

    On the console, go to My Xbox and select System Settings.

    Select Network Settings.

    Select WiredNet or the name of the wireless network (if prompted to do so).

    Select Test Xbox LIVE Connection.

    If you don't get an MTU error message after simplifying the configuration, the router might be having difficulty managing multiple connections. To try to solve the problem, try the next solution.

    Solution 4: Check the MTU setting

    Xbox LIVE requires a minimum MTU setting of 1364. Make sure your router or gateway has an MTU setting of 1364 or higher. To do this, log into the router or gateway and check the MTU setting. See the documentation provided with your router or gateway for information on how to make this change.

    If you change the MTU setting on your networking hardware, reset it and retest your Xbox LIVE connection.

    If the MTU setting on your router or gateway is 1364 or higher, try the next solution.
